Abstract

In this work the study of the optical properties of skin tissues using Raman spectroscopy and autofluorescence analysis was performed. The analysis of different skin neoplasms was carried out based on the Raman and autofluorescence spectra stimulated by 785 nm laser. In this study the spectral data was processed by different mathematical methods allowed for effective classification of malignant and benign tumors. The proposed diagnostic methods helped to achieve 82.1-87% differentiation accuracy of skin neoplasms.
